To: Transcontinental Gas Pipe Line Corporation Customers and Shippers

Re: Market Area IT Availability - November 21, 2000

The available interruptible transportation service (IT and secondary FT)
on Transco for pipeline day Tuesday, November 21, 2000 and continuing
until further notice is summarized as follows:

Tier I and Tier II (only Sta. 90 through Sta. 180 affected) 0 MDt/day

South Virginia Lateral Compressor Station 167 OPEN

Tier III (Station 180 through East) 0 MDt/day

Leidy - at Centerville Regulator Station (Only 150 MDt/day
Deliveries downstream of Centerville regulator affected)

Linden Regulator Station 100 MDt/day
(Located in Union County, New Jersey)

Mobile Bay Lateral 107 MDt/day

The above available interruptible transportation service refers to
deliveries into the affected area that have receipts upstream of
the bottleneck or affected area.
